Brass, an alloy primarily composed of copper and zinc, offers a unique blend of properties that make it suitable for press fittings. Depending on the zinc content, brass can be categorized into various grades, each with distinct mechanical and corrosion-resistant characteristics. The addition of small amounts of other elements like lead, tin, or aluminum can further enhance its properties, särskilt dess temperaturmotstånd .

Påverkan på temperaturmotstånd

Brass's composition significantly impacts its ability to withstand temperature extremes. High-zinc brass grades tend to exhibit better corrosion resistance but may have lower temperature limits. Conversely, copper-rich brass grades often have higher melting points and improved high-temperature performance. Understanding the precise alloy composition is crucial for selecting the right brass press fitting För specifika temperaturapplikationer .

Low-temperature testing of brass press fittings is equally critical, especially in applications exposed to freezing conditions. Tests involve immersing samples in liquid nitrogen or using controlled refrigeration units to achieve temperatures as low as -40℃or below. Key performance indicators include brittleness, impact resistance, and sealing efficiency.

Prestationsanalys

Despite brass's relatively low ductility at very low temperatures, press fittings demonstrate remarkable resilience. Proper annealing and tempering processes during manufacturing enhance their cryogenic properties, allowing them to maintain flexibility and strength. Testing has shown that brass press fittings can retain their sealing force and withstand pressure variations without leakage, even in extreme kall .

When selecting brass press fittings for high or low-temperature applications, engineers must consider factors such as the specific alloy grade, the maximum and minimum operating temperatures, and the pressure ratings. Additionally, understanding the long-term effects of temperature cycling on brass's mechanical properties is essential to ensure sustained performance and durability.
